Putaway is the essential process of moving received stock into storage locations to make it available for sale. ShipHero Putaway V2 provides advanced control over floor operations, allowing for precise management of complex inventory movements.
Why Putaway Matters for Your Business
In a busy warehouse, misplaced inventory leads to shipment delays. For ShipHero users, the Putaway tool provides several key benefits:
- Consolidates stock and Maximizes Space: Locate existing product bins to prevent items from being scattered and quickly identifies empty or available locations.
- Improves Accuracy: Real-time logging ensures that "Available to Sell" numbers remain precise.
- Direct Replenishment: Identify items flagged with the Replen tag to replenish pickable locations before adding new inventory to overstock locations.

Key Enhancements in Putaway V2
1. LPN Support and Nesting
Putaway V2 introduces comprehensive License Plate Number (LPN) support. This allows operators to scan a single barcode to move an entire pallet or container.
- LPN Nesting: Move multiple sub-containers within a larger pallet as a single unit.
- LPN Unpacking: Unlike previous versions, you can unpack specific items from an LPN directly during the putaway process.
2. Specialized Handling and Unit of Measure (UOM) Support
Managing different units, such as individual items versus cases, is streamlined in V2.
- Dedicated UOM Screen: A specific interface handles various Units of Measure to reduce quantity errors.
- Unique ID Filtering: V2 uses Unique IDs to distinguish between different batches of the same SKU across multiple locations.
3. Real-Time Visibility
V2 provides immediate feedback on task progress.
- Completion Screens: A dedicated screen confirms all items were moved correctly upon task completion.
- Summary Tracking: Operators can access a comprehensive list of all moved inventory during the session.

Building Your Putaway List (Draft Mode)
Before moving physical stock, you must create a Draft List. This acts as your digital manifest of items that require a new location.
- Navigate to the Products > Putaway screen in the ShipHero Mobile App.
-
Scan one of the following:
Method Result Additional Notes/Limitations Scan an Item or Case Putaway V2 automatically goes into SKU-Filtered mode, and shows only locations containing that SKU. Select the source location and confirm the quantity that needs to be moved. Single SKU per list.
Single origin location per list.
Scan a Location All items and LPNs in that location are automatically added to the Putaway list list. Multiple Locations can be added to a list. Scan an LPN The LPN is added to the Putaway list and the assigned location of the LPN is displayed. Multiple LPNs can be added to a list. - Repeat until your draft list is complete. Then select Start Putaway to save your Putaway list.
Removing an Item/LPN from a Putaway Draft list
If you need to remove a LPN or item from the Putaway List, tap on the card and click on remove at the top right corner.
Executing the Transfer (In Progress)
Once your list is complete, select Start Putaway. The list is now locked, and you may begin the physical movement of stock.
Step-by-Step: Putaway loose stock (individual SKUs)
- Select the Item: Tap or scan the item on the putaway list to move.
- Scan the Destination: Locate an empty bin or existing location for the product and scan its barcode. Use the Pickable or Sellable filters to narrow the list of locations.
- Confirm Quantity: Scan the items as you place them in the bin, enter the quantity manually or select Put away all units to move the full amount.
- Save and Sync: Select Complete to save the move. ShipHero updates the inventory logs in real-time. A Green Check indicates the task is complete; an Orange Check indicates a partial movement.
Step-by-Step: Putaway LPNs
When using the Putaway feature with LPNs you have several options on how to complete the invetory move. Follow the instrustuctions below:
Scan LPN barcode or Tap on LPN card to start its putaway. The app prompts you to Scan Destination for the LPN
-
Go to the destination Location or LPN and scan its barcode. A pop-up appears with transfer options; depending on the outcome you need select one of the following methods to transgfer the inventory/LPN
Method 1: Move an Entire LPN to a Destination Location
After scanning the Destination Location barcode, to move the entire LPN and its contents, tap the “Transfer entire LPN” button.
On the Putaway summary tab you will see the performed action of moving the LPN to its new Location.

Method 2: Unpack an LPN at Destination Location
After scanning a Destination Location barcode, to unpack the items from the LPN into the location, the user taps on the “product details card”. This action takes you to the unpack items Screen.
-
Scan the item’s SKU barcode to set the amount of items of the SKU you want to unpack from LPN.
You can also set the amount manually by tapping on “Enter manually” option at the bottom.
If you wish to unpack all units of the SKU from LPN then you can tap on “Put away all units” option at the bottom.
On the Putaway summary tab you will see the performed action of unpacking items of an SKU from the LPN to their new Location.

Method 3: Nest an Entire LPN in a Destination LPN
After scanning a Destination LPN barcode, to nest the LPN into Destination LPN, tap the “Transfer entire LPN” button.
On the Putaway summary tab you will see the performed action of nesting the LPN into Destination LPN.

Method 4: Transfer items from a LPN to a Destination LPN
After scanning a Destination LPN barcode, to transfer loose items of a SKU from the LPN to the Destination LPN, tap on the “product details card”.
-
Scan the item’s SKU barcode to set the amount of items of the SKU you want to transfer from LPN
You can also set the amount manually by tapping on “Enter manually” option at the bottom
If you wish to transfer all units of the SKU from LPN then you can tap on “Put away all units” option at the bottom.
On the Putaway summary scrollable tab you will see the performed action of transferring items of an SKU from the LPN to another LPN.

Completing your Putaway List
Once all tasks on your list are complete, the app displays a "Ta-da, all done!" confirmation screen.
From here, you can choose to View putaway summary to review the movements you just completed or select Create a new putaway list to begin another task.
Frequently Asked Questions
| Question | Answer |
| Can I add different SKUs from different aisles to one list? | Yes. You can scan multiple items and locations to build a comprehensive move-list. However, the SKU-filtered mode, (triggered when an item barcode is scanned), only supports a single SKU from a single location at this time. |
| What if I do not finish the entire list? | Any items successfully transferred are saved. Remaining items stay in their original location. |
| Can two people work on the same list? | Lists are session-based, but multiple users can create separate lists for the same items if needed. |
| How do I handle Replenishment? | ShipHero highlights priority items with a replenishment badge for immediate restocking. |
